Things to consider
Higher = more presentNo sexual content is present in the story.
The burglars are repeatedly thwarted with cartoonish violence.
No profanity is used by the characters.
No blasphemous language is present.
No substance use is depicted.
No instances of suicide or self-harm occur.
The burglars might be mildly scary to very young readers.
No occult themes are present.
No LGBTQ+ themes are present.
The story promotes resourcefulness and family togetherness.
No negative portrayals of Christians or God are present.
Virtues to celebrate
Higher = stronger presenceKevin shows courage in defending his home.
No explicit Christian faith elements are present.
Family love is a central theme.
Forgiveness is shown when Kevin's family returns.
